Catalog description

Introduction to the basics of DC electrical circuit theory for electrical engineering and other technology majors. Study of methods for analyzing resistive circuits. Circuits incorporating independent and dependent energy sources are studied. Methods covered include Ohm's Law, Kirchhoff's Laws, nodal analysis, loop analysis, superposition, Thevenin's Theorem, Norton's Theorem, and the maximum power transfer principle. Computer software tools such as MATLAB and MultiSim will be introduced.
